Handover — cron drift, Pellis batch tier. Drift traced to NTP flapping on the Orvane hosts; jobs slipping ~40s/day. Patched chrony config on half the fleet; rest pending. Dashboards updated. If the scheduler admin session dies mid-rollout, recover via the Pellis break-glass login. For that login you'll need the recovery passphrase, noted right below for the sync.

unlock words, yawig-kagef: gordor-holvan-ulaael-pramir-ulaiel-tamdor

### Meeting notes — Ladleworks scaling calculator (security review excerpt)

Reviewed input handling for the recipe-scaling calculator. Fraction parsing now rejects malformed unicode inputs, and unit conversion tables are loaded read-only at startup. Open item: rate limiting on the public scaling endpoint is still unimplemented and must land before beta. Follow-up actions and the audit checklist are owned by the individual named below.

account owner for bawip-tahag: Raleth Quenok

## Step 3: Pin the Component Library Version

As of Brindlewick UI v4, shared components no longer float on the latest minor release. Each consuming app must pin an exact version in its manifest before upgrading. Skipping this step causes mismatched theme tokens at build time. Update your manifest to match the values below, then rerun the bundler.

deployment values, tahaf-fajog:
[ralmir]
host = ralmir.paliqcorp.internal
user = ralmir_svc
database = ralmir_prod